Are cheese croissants vegan?

Cheese croissants are a mouth-watering pastry that perfectly blends the buttery goodness of a classic French croissant with the savory tanginess of cheese. These flaky treats feature layers of delicate, buttery pastry dough folded around a filling of melted, gooey cheese. Each bite is a heavenly experience, with a crispy outer layer giving way to a soft and chewy center packed with rich, cheesy flavor. Whether enjoyed as a breakfast treat or a mid-day snack, cheese croissants are an indulgent and satisfying choice for any occasion.

Cheese croissants is a non-vegan food ingredient.
